Israel stocks higher at close of trade; TA 35 up 0.25%

Investing.com – Israel stocks were higher after the close on Tuesday, as gains in the Banking, Financials and Insurance sectors led shares higher.

At the close in Tel Aviv, the TA 35 added 0.25%.

The best performers of the session on the TA 35 were Nova (TASE:NVMI), which rose 2.76% or 2,100.00 points to trade at 78,100.00 at the close. Meanwhile, Bezeq Israeli Telecommunication Corp Ltd (TASE:BEZQ) added 1.89% or 8.00 points to end at 430.50 and Leumi (TASE:LUMI) was up 1.88% or 66.00 points to 3,579.00 in late trade.

The worst performers of the session were ICL Israel Chemicals Ltd (TASE:ICL), which fell 2.91% or 45.00 points to trade at 1,500.00 at the close. Israel Corp (TASE:ILCO) declined 2.58% or 2,020.00 points to end at 76,380.00 and NICE Ltd (TASE:NICE) was down 2.38% or 1,560.00 points to 64,000.00.

Falling stocks outnumbered advancing ones on the Tel Aviv Stock Exchange by 267 to 182 and 91 ended unchanged.

Crude oil for November delivery was down 4.47% or 3.45 to $73.69 a barrel. Elsewhere in commodities trading, Brent oil for delivery in December fell 4.34% or 3.51 to hit $77.42 a barrel, while the December Gold Futures contract fell 0.87% or 23.10 to trade at $2,642.90 a troy ounce.

USD/ILS was down 0.65% to 3.76, while EUR/ILS fell 0.70% to 4.13.

The US Dollar Index Futures was up 0.03% at 102.33.
